Essential Responsibilities Clinical Duties
- Escort patients to exam rooms and prepare them for evaluation.
- Obtain and accurately document vital signs, medical history, medications, allergies, and chief complaints.
- Prepare examination rooms and maintain adequate medical supplies.
- Assist physicians and nurse practitioners during examinations and procedures.
- Administer injections, immunizations, and medications as permitted by certification and state regulations.
- Perform EKGs, vision testing, and other office procedures.
- Collect and prepare laboratory specimens and perform CLIA-waived laboratory testing.
- Sterilize and maintain medical instruments according to infection control standards.
- Provide patient education regarding medications, treatment plans, and preventive health measures.
- Process prescription refill requests according to provider protocols.
- Coordinate referrals, diagnostic testing, and follow-up appointments.
- Maintain accurate and timely documentation within the electronic health record (EHR).
Administrative Duties
- Answer patient telephone calls professionally and accurately document messages.
- Obtain prior authorizations for medications, imaging, and procedures.
- Complete insurance forms and other clinical documentation.
- Maintain patient confidentiality in accordance with HIPAA regulations.
- Assist with inventory management and ordering of medical supplies.
- Support quality improvement initiatives and participate in team meetings.
